/*
Copyright (c) 2008, Yahoo! Inc. All rights reserved.
Code licensed under the BSD License:
http://developer.yahoo.net/yui/license.txt
version: 2.5.1
*/
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}
body {text-align:center;background: #f9f9f9;color: #333333;font-size: 15px;font-family: "trebuchet ms", helvetica, sans-serif;}
table{border-collapse:collapse;border-spacing:0;}
img{border:0;}
em,strong,th,var{font-style:normal;font-weight:normal;}
li{list-style:none;}
input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it;}
input,textarea,select{*font-size:100%;}
table {font-size:inherit;font:100%;}
.invsbl {display: none;}
h1 {font-size:124%; }
h2 {	font-size:124%; }
h3 {font-size:108%; }
h1,h2,h3 {margin:0 0 1em 0;}
h1,h2,h3,h4,h5,h6,strong {font-weight:700; }
em {	font-style:italic;}
blockquote,ul,ol,dl {margin:1em;}
ol,ul,dl {margin-left:2em;}
ol li {	list-style: decimal outside;	}
ul li {	list-style: disc outside;}
th {font-weight:bold;	text-align:center;}
p,fieldset,table,pre {margin-bottom:1em;}
input[type=text],input[type=password],textarea{width:12.25em;*width:11.9em;}

/**/

#mainlay,.yui-t5{margin:auto;text-align:left;width:57.69em;*width:56.25em;min-width:750px;}
#mainlay{margin:auto;width:73.076em;*width:71.25em; border-left:2px solid #ddd;background:#fff;border-right:2px solid #ddd;background:#fff;}

.yui-b{position:relative;}
.yui-b{_position:static;}
#yui-main .yui-b{position:static;}
#yui-main{width:100%;}
.yui-t5 #yui-main{float:left;margin-right:-25em;}

.yui-t5 .yui-b{float:right;width:18.4615em;*width:18.00em;}
.yui-t5 #yui-main .yui-b{margin-right:19.4615em;*margin-right:19.125em;}

#yui-main .yui-b{float:none;width:auto;}
#bd:after{content:".";display:block;height:0;clear:both;visibility:hidden;}

/*---------------------------------*/
.divider {font-size: 0px;position: relative;border-bottom: solid 1px #F5F5F5;height: 1px;width: 100%;margin: 10px 0px 10px 0px;}
.cbut {width:70px;padding:4px;margin-bottom:1px; float:left;}
.cbud {width:110px;padding:4px;margin-bottom:1px;background:#e0e0e0; float:left;border-right:1px solid #fff;}
.dow {margin-bottom:8px;}
.updow {margin:10px 0;}

hr {border:0px;background:#ddd;height:1px;}

#footer {clear: both;border-top:4px solid #ddd;margin: 0px auto;margin-top:16px;padding: 6px 0;text-align: center;font-size: 11px;}
#hd {border-bottom:4px solid #ddd;text-align:center;margin-bottom:12px;}
#header {margin: 0px auto;text-align:left;}


a,a.blt,a.blt:link { color:#007ac4; text-decoration:none; }
a:visited,a.blt:visited { color:#6699cc; text-decoration:none; }
a:hover,a.blt:hover { color:#007ac4; text-decoration:underline; }


.tocard, .tocard:visited, .contentBlock .tocard, .contentBlock .tocard:visited{
	display:inline-block;padding:5px 10px 4px;color:#fff;text-decoration:none;position:relative;cursor:pointer;}
.tocard:hover, .contentBlock .tocard:hover{background-color:#111;color:#fff;}
.tocard:active, .contentBlock .tocard:active,{top:1px;}
.tocard, .tocard:visited , .contentBlock .tocard, .contentBlock .tocard:visited{font-size:14px;font-weight:bold;line-height:1;text-shadow:0 -1px 1px rgba(0,0,0,0.25);}
.pla.tocard, .pla.tocard:visited, .contentBlock .pla.tocard, .contentBlock .pla.tocard:visited{background:#2dab33;color:#fff;border-top:0;border-left:0;border-right:0;border-bottom:2px solid #39892f;}
.pla.tocard:hover, .contentBlock .pla.tocard:hover{background-color:#39892f;color:#fff;border-bottom:2px solid #39892f;text-decoration: none;}
